The Factory Finish Process
The process of using a factory finish to a composite door is a multi-step procedure that includes accuracy and proficiency. Here are the crucial phases:
Preparation:
- Surface Cleaning: The door is completely cleaned up to remove any dust, debris, or contaminants that could disrupt the finish.
- Surface Conditioning: The surface is conditioned to guarantee that the finish adheres effectively. This might include sanding or applying a primer.
Base Coat Application:
- Primer: A primer is applied to create a smooth, even surface and to improve the adhesion of the overcoat.
- Base Coat: The base coat is applied, which can be a strong color or a wood grain pattern, depending on the preferred visual.
Top Coat Application:
- Top Coat: A durable leading coat is used to provide the final layer of defense and to achieve the preferred finish (e.g., matte, semi-gloss, or gloss).
- Curing: The door is allowed to treat in a controlled environment to make sure that the finish sets correctly.
Quality assurance:
- Inspection: The completed door is checked for any defects, such as bubbles, scratches, or unequal application.
- Final Touches: Any needed touch-ups are made to ensure a flawless finish.
Products Used in Factory Finishing
The products used in the factory finish of composite doors are carefully selected to guarantee resilience and efficiency. Typical materials consist of:
- Acrylic Resins: These provide exceptional adhesion and resistance to UV rays.
- Polyurethane: Known for its strength and versatility, polyurethane is often used in top coats to supply a long lasting, long-lasting finish.
- Solvent-Based Finishes: These are known for their quick drying times and high gloss finishes.
- Water-Based Finishes: These are ecologically friendly and provide a series of finishes from matte to high gloss.

Frequently Asked Questions About Composite Door Factory Finish
Q: How long does a factory finish last?A: An effectively applied factory finish can last for 20 years or more, depending on the quality of the products and the care of the door.
Q: Can a factory finish be repaired if it gets damaged?A: Yes, small damage can often be repaired by applying touch-up paint or a repair kit. However, for more considerable damage, it might be essential to refinish the whole door.
Q: Are factory finishes more expensive than DIY surfaces?A: Generally, factory surfaces are more costly due to the top quality materials and regulated application procedure. However, they offer exceptional durability and a professional finish, which can be more cost-effective in the long run.
Q: Can composite doors be painted after installation?A: While it is possible to paint composite doors after installation, it is typically not suggested. The factory finish is designed to be extremely resilient and resistant to the elements, and painting over it can compromise its stability.
Q: What is the very best way to keep a factory-finished composite door?A: Regular cleaning with a mild detergent and water is normally enough to keep the finish. Prevent using abrasive cleaners or harsh chemicals, as these can damage the surface area.
